Revolutionary Yield-Bearing Stablecoin Launches On Polygon: Boost Your DeFi Returns

Are you ready to supercharge your DeFi portfolio? Ant Financial’s RWA protocol has just launched a game-changing yield-bearing stablecoin on Polygon, promising both stability and passive income. This innovative move could redefine how we use stablecoins in decentralized finance.

What Is a Yield-Bearing Stablecoin and Why Does It Matter?

A yield-bearing stablecoin combines the reliability of a pegged asset with the earning potential of yield generation. Unlike traditional stablecoins that simply hold their value, this new offering from R25, Ant Financial’s real-world asset protocol, automatically generates returns from money market funds and structured notes. Therefore, it maintains its $1 peg while growing your holdings.

How Does the rcUSD+ Stablecoin Work on Polygon?

The rcUSD+ stablecoin operates by leveraging real-world assets to produce yield. Here’s how it benefits users:

  • Stable Value: It consistently holds a $1 peg, reducing volatility risks.
  • Passive Income: Yield is generated automatically from diversified investments.
  • Ecosystem Integration: It will be supplied across Polygon’s DeFi platforms, enhancing liquidity.

Moreover, by building on Polygon, it taps into low transaction fees and high scalability, making it accessible to a broader audience.

What Are the Key Benefits of This Yield-Bearing Stablecoin?

This yield-bearing stablecoin offers multiple advantages for crypto enthusiasts. First, it provides a safe haven during market fluctuations, as the peg ensures stability. Second, the built-in yield mechanism means your assets work for you without active management. Additionally, integration into Polygon’s DeFi ecosystem allows for seamless use in lending, borrowing, and trading.

Are There Any Challenges to Consider?

While promising, this yield-bearing stablecoin faces hurdles. Regulatory scrutiny on real-world assets could impact growth. Also, reliance on money market funds introduces traditional financial risks. However, Ant Financial’s backing adds credibility, potentially mitigating these concerns.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a yield-bearing stablecoin?
A yield-bearing stablecoin is a digital asset that maintains a stable value, like $1, while earning interest or yield from underlying investments, such as money market funds.

How does rcUSD+ maintain its peg?
rcUSD+ uses yield generated from real-world assets like structured notes and money market funds to uphold its $1 value, ensuring stability.

Is the yield-bearing stablecoin safe?
While it offers benefits, risks include market fluctuations and regulatory changes. Ant Financial’s involvement provides some assurance, but always research before investing.

Where can I use rcUSD+?
It will be available across various DeFi applications on the Polygon network, including lending protocols and decentralized exchanges.

What makes this yield-bearing stablecoin different?
Unlike standard stablecoins, it automatically generates yield, combining stability with growth potential without user intervention.

Can I lose money with a yield-bearing stablecoin?
There’s a risk if the underlying assets underperform or in extreme market conditions, but the peg mechanism aims to minimize losses.

The post Taiko Makes Chainlink Data Streams Its Official Oracle appeared on BitcoinEthereumNews.com. Key Notes Taiko has officially integrated Chainlink Data Streams for its Layer 2 network. The integration provides developers with high-speed market data to build advanced DeFi applications. The move aims to improve security and attract institutional adoption by using Chainlink’s established infrastructure. Taiko, an Ethereum-based ETH $4 514 24h volatility: 0.4% Market cap: $545.57 B Vol. 24h: $28.23 B Layer 2 rollup, has announced the integration of Chainlink LINK $23.26 24h volatility: 1.7% Market cap: $15.75 B Vol. 24h: $787.15 M Data Streams. The development comes as the underlying Ethereum network continues to see significant on-chain activity, including large sales from ETH whales. The partnership establishes Chainlink as the official oracle infrastructure for the network. It is designed to provide developers on the Taiko platform with reliable and high-speed market data, essential for building a wide range of decentralized finance (DeFi) applications, from complex derivatives platforms to more niche projects involving unique token governance models. According to the project’s official announcement on Sept. 17, the integration enables the creation of more advanced on-chain products that require high-quality, tamper-proof data to function securely. Taiko operates as a “based rollup,” which means it leverages Ethereum validators for transaction sequencing for strong decentralization. Boosting DeFi and Institutional Interest Oracles are fundamental services in the blockchain industry. They act as secure bridges that feed external, off-chain information to on-chain smart contracts. DeFi protocols, in particular, rely on oracles for accurate, real-time price feeds. Taiko leadership stated that using Chainlink’s infrastructure aligns with its goals. The team hopes the partnership will help attract institutional crypto investment and support the development of real-world applications, a goal that aligns with Chainlink’s broader mission to bring global data on-chain. Kalshi Prediction Markets Are Pulling In $1 Billion Monthly as State Regulators Loom

Kalshi Prediction Markets Are Pulling In $1 Billion Monthly as State Regulators Loom

The post Kalshi Prediction Markets Are Pulling In $1 Billion Monthly as State Regulators Loom appeared on BitcoinEthereumNews.com. In brief Kalshi reached $1 billion in monthly volume and now dominates 62% of the global prediction market industry, surpassing Polymarket’s 37% share. Four states including Massachusetts have filed lawsuits claiming Kalshi operates as an unlicensed sportsbook, with Massachusetts seeking to permanently bar the platform. Kalshi operates under federal CFTC regulation as a designated contract market, arguing this preempts state gambling laws that require separate licensing. Prediction market Kalshi just topped $1 billion in monthly volume as state regulators nip at its heels with lawsuits alleging that it’s an unregistered sports betting platform. “Despite being limited to only American customers, Kalshi has now risen to dominate the global prediction market industry,” the company said in a press release. “New data scraped from publicly available activity metrics details this rise.” The publicly available data appears on a Dune Analytics dashboard that’s been tracking prediction market notional volume. The data show that Kalshi now accounts for roughly 62% of global prediction market volume, Polymarket for 37%, and the rest split between Limitless and Myriad, the prediction market owned by Decrypt parent company Dastan. Trading volume on Kalshi skyrocketed in August, not coincidentally at the start of the NFL season and as the prediction market pushes further into sports.  But regulators in Maryland, Nevada, and New Jersey have all issued cease-and-desist orders, arguing Kalshi’s event contracts amount to unlicensed sports betting. Each case has spilled into federal court, with judges issuing preliminary rulings but no final decisions yet. Last week, Massachusetts went further, filing a lawsuit that calls Kalshi’s sports contracts “illegal and unsafe sports wagering.” The 43-page Massachusetts lawsuit seeks to stop the company from allowing state residents on its platform—much the way Coinbase has had to do with its staking offerings in parts of the United States.
